There were two bikes in RSE: the Acro Bike, which let you do sweet tricks, and the Mach Bike, which let you zoom around at high speeds. Both played a role in helping you get to different areas and explore all the region had to offer.

What do you think will become of this dual-bike mechanic?

To me, it was an awesome feature, but it was tedious to have to go back and forth to exchange your bike every time you wanted to switch. I'm hoping that with the circle pad and D-pad, you have only one bike, and when you use the circle pad it switches to Mach mode, and using the D-pad activates Acro mode (DPP did something similar with "gears," but it only switched how fast you went). Or maybe it's the other way around, and you can do tricks on your Acro bike similar to how you can perform stunts with your skates in XY.

Anyway, I don't see why they wouldn't bring these bikes back, but I don't want gears, because you would need to choose between the benefits of these bikes. I really didn't like that the Acro Bike wasn't good for doing anything major, since with the Mach Bike you could set cycling records, get a fossil and get Rayquaza. Besides, it was really fast transport. I would have really loved it if they made some thing important (like the Regis) only accessible through the Acro Bike. The only thing we can do is go to a few misc. places to get stuff like Leaf Stone or climb the Jagged Pass without having to use the Cable Car.
